Liquor Stores nearby Shop 32A & B, Kuilsrivier Center, Van Riebeek Str, Cape Town, 7580, South Africa



tops at SPAR

Approximately 0.3 km away
Address: Shop 67, Aroma Centre, Van Riebeeck Road, Kuils River, Cape Town, South Africa

LIQUOR CITY

Approximately 0.78 km away
Address: 3, Cindal Centre, Van Riebeeck Road, Kuils River, Cape Town, 7680, South Africa

Pop Inn BLUE BOTTLE LIQUORS

Approximately 1.15 km away
Address: 100 Van Riebeeck Road, Kuils River, Cape Town, South Africa

Liquorland Kuilsrivier

Approximately 1.65 km away
Address: 114 Van Riebeeck Road, Kuils River, Kuils River, 7580, South Africa

Liquor City

Approximately 1.73 km away
Address: Shop 37 Ipic Shop Ctr, Bottelary Rd, Kuils River, 7580, South Africa